M109 (Nose-Impact Fuze)
The M109 was a World War Two (WW2)-era, US Army (US Army) developed, mechanical and pyrotechnic, delayed-arming, instantaneous-action, high-sensitivity, nose impact fuze. The M109 was known to have been used with the M41 (AN-M41) series fragmentation bomb. If utilised with a spotting charge the M109 could be used with the M48 fragmentation practice bomb.
